Greenland Meltwater‍ Fuels ⁢Rising‌ Temperatures Across Europe

The recent findings highlighting the impact ⁣of⁢ Greenland meltwater on ⁢European temperatures reveal a concerning trend.⁣ As glaciers and ice sheets continue to thaw⁢ at⁢ an unprecedented rate due to climate change,vast quantities of meltwater are flowing into ​the⁤ North Atlantic. This influx⁢ of ‌fresh water disrupts ‌ocean currents, particularly the Atlantic Meridional ‍Overturning Circulation (AMOC), which⁢ plays a crucial role in regulating climate patterns across Europe. ​Consequently, the warming​ waters ‍contribute to ​a ⁤series of extreme heatwaves that​ have become increasingly common in the region.

Key ‌factors related to ⁢this phenomenon include:⁣

  • Feedback Loops: The reduction⁤ of ice cover ⁢leads to less sunlight being reflected ‌away from the ​Earth, causing further warming.
  • Weather Patterns: ⁤Altered ‍ocean currents can intensify⁤ atmospheric conditions that create​ prolonged periods ⁣of heat⁤ in Europe.
  • Local Impacts: ‍ Regions previously characterized by temperate ​weather are experiencing record-high temperatures, ‍affecting ‍agriculture and natural ecosystems.

⁣
these interconnected dynamics‌ underscore the gravity of the situation, as scientists urge​ immediate⁣ action⁣ to mitigate the broader impacts of climate change on both ⁢a local⁤ and ‍global scale.

Understanding the Link Between Climate Change and ​Extreme Weather ​Events

Recent studies reveal a compelling connection between​ the‌ dramatic melt of Greenland’s ice sheets ‍and the increasing⁣ intensity​ of heatwaves across Europe. Researchers have found that ⁣the influx of cold meltwater into the North Atlantic disrupts⁣ ocean currents, leading⁣ to unusual atmospheric patterns. These​ shifts can ⁣exacerbate⁢ heat conditions,making them more severe ⁢and prolonged.⁢ As ⁤a result,​ regions ‌in Europe that might⁣ typically experience ⁤moderate summer‍ heat are now grappling with unprecedented temperatures, contributing to health risks and economic strain.

Key contributing factors to‍ this phenomenon include: ‍

  • Increased ⁤Sea Surface Temperatures: The colder meltwater alters the thermal dynamics of the North Atlantic, influencing weather systems across Europe.
  • Jet Stream Disruption: the variations ⁢in temperature ‌can ‌weaken ‌the⁤ jet‍ stream,resulting in prolonged heat‍ events ‌and​ stalling weather patterns.
  • Feedback Loops: ⁤ The ⁤intensification of heatwaves can lead to further ice melt, thereby perpetuating the cycle of extreme weather‍ events.

⁣
Understanding these interconnections is crucial‍ for developing effective strategies to⁢ mitigate the impacts‌ of ⁢climate change on both local and global ⁤scales.

Mitigating ⁢Heatwave Risks: Strategies for Adaptation and Resilience

As ⁣Greenland’s ⁣ice sheets​ continue to melt,⁣ the implications for⁤ Europe are becoming increasingly evident.The influx of meltwater has‌ been linked to​ an ⁤uptick⁤ in heatwaves across the continent, exacerbating the already serious impact of ‍climate change. In response, experts​ emphasize the need for​ robust adaptation ⁤strategies​ that can ​help mitigate these rising temperatures and their⁢ associated risks. Key measures identified ‍include urban planning that prioritizes green spaces, enhancing the ⁤capacity of‌ urban infrastructures⁣ to handle⁢ extreme heat, and promoting public awareness about heat-related health risks.

Moreover, resilience can ‍be ​bolstered through ​proactive approaches in agriculture⁤ and water management. Investing⁢ in technologies that ‍enhance irrigation efficiency and ‌drought ​resistance in crops is‌ vital, as is ⁣the growth of policies that ‍ensure water conservation. Additionally,‌ incorporating early warning systems ‌can⁢ considerably⁢ enhance community readiness ⁣for heatwaves, allowing residents to take precautionary measures. Collaboration between ⁤governments, NGOs, and local⁢ communities will be ⁢crucial in fostering an integrated response to tackle the increasingly intense heatwaves linked to climate ‌phenomena like those caused by Greenland’s meltwater.
